  1. Conduct thorough and accurate credentialing and recredentialing for healthcare providers in compliance with organizational policies and regulatory requirements.
  2. Verify and maintain accurate provider information, including licensure, certifications, and malpractice insurance.
  3. Communicate with providers to obtain necessary documentation and resolve any credentialing issues in a timely manner.
  4. Create and maintain provider files and databases, ensuring all information is up-to-date and organized.
  5. Collaborate with internal teams, such as human resources and legal, to ensure all credentialing processes align with organizational standards.
  6. Monitor and track expiration dates for provider credentials, ensuring timely renewals are completed.
  7. Stay updated on changes in regulations and requirements related to provider credentialing, and make necessary adjustments to processes and procedures.
  8. Assist in the development and implementation of credentialing policies and procedures.
  9. Educate providers on credentialing requirements and assist in the onboarding process for new providers.
  10. Maintain confidentiality and adhere to HIPAA regulations when handling sensitive provider information.
  11. Serve as a liaison between the organization and outside agencies, such as insurance companies and accrediting bodies, to provide necessary credentialing information.
  12. Participate in audits and reviews of the credentialing process to ensure accuracy and compliance.
  13. Adhere to strict timelines and deadlines for credentialing activities.
  14. Identify and report any potential compliance or regulatory issues related to credentialing.
  15. Continuously evaluate and improve the credentialing process to enhance efficiency and accuracy.

Job Qualifications
  • Bachelor's Degree In Healthcare Administration, Business Administration, Or A Related Field.

  • Minimum Of 2 Years Of Experience In Managed Care Credentialing, Preferably In A Healthcare Setting.

  • Knowledge Of Credentialing Standards And Regulations, Including Ncqa, Cms, And Joint Commission.

  • Strong Attention To Detail And Ability To Maintain Accurate And Organized Credentialing Records.

  • Excellent Communication And Interpersonal Skills To Effectively Interact With Providers, Colleagues, And External Stakeholders.

About Orlando Health

Orlando Health is a private, not-for-profit network of community and specialty hospitals based in Orlando, Florida. Orlando Health has award-winning hospitals, clinics and over 2000 physicians throughout Central Florida.
